Grapefruit Seed Extract for Nail Fungus: A Natural Treatment
Grapefruit seed extract has many uses for treating infections and ailments. It is especially effective in the treatment of nail fungus.-

Use
-
When using grapefruit seed extract to cure nail fungus infections, add five to 10 drops of the extract to 1 tablespoon of water. Soak your nails for a few minutes at least twice a day until the infection is gone.

Warning
-
Make sure that you do not put grapefruit seed extract in your eyes. It must always be diluted before using on sensitive body parts, such as your nose, ears and mouth. If contact or irritation occurs, flush with water for 10 minutes.
